Starting in 2001, with a modest start in mountain bike racing, he was asked to participate in the bike leg of a sprint triathlon relay. Upon witnessing the impressive display of half-ironman athletes running to place their bikes into T2 to get on with their half marathon, after 56 miles on the bike course, he was hooked with the idea of doing a half-ironman one day. Just weeks after graduating high school, he fulfilled that dream. Having witnessed the race, his high school swim coach challenged him to compete in Ironman Arizona with him the following year. With some money saved up from working at the local bike shop, he took him up on the idea of entering the race. He didn’t tell his parents about his decision until months later when the three hour training runs became suspicious. In April 2008, he crossed the finish line in Phoenix. This would be the first of many Ironman events to come.

Lee’s athletic journey expanded to encompass various disciplines, including road and trail running races up to marathon distance and obstacle course racing through the Spartan series. He notably qualified for and competed in prestigious events such as the Ironman 70.3 Worlds (2022 & 2024) and the Spartan North American Championships. Additionally, as a ranked professional Spartan obstacle course athlete, he demonstrates his commitment to excellence in multiple disciplines.
